Frequently Asked Questions
🚇 🗺️ Getting There
The Basilica is located in Morella, a town known for its historical charm. If you're coming from Valencia or Peniscola, it's a scenic drive. Public transport options might be limited, so consider a car for easier access.
Parking in Morella can be challenging due to its medieval layout. Look for designated parking areas outside the old town walls and be prepared for a short walk.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
It's crucial to check the exact closing time before your visit, as they can vary. Arriving well before closing ensures you have ample time to explore.
There is a small entry fee, which many visitors find to be excellent value for the experience and the historical artifacts on display.
Information on online ticket purchases is not widely available. It's generally recommended to purchase tickets upon arrival at the basilica.
🎫 🏛️ Onsite Experience
The interior is the main attraction, featuring beautiful architecture, religious artifacts, statues, and paintings that reflect the basilica's rich history.
Yes, the stunning interior offers many opportunities for photography. However, be mindful of any posted restrictions and be respectful of ongoing services.
A visit can take anywhere from 30 minutes to an hour, depending on your interest in the historical artifacts and the overall atmosphere.
🍽️ 🍽️ Food & Dining
Morella is a charming town with several restaurants and cafes offering local cuisine. You can find dining options within walking distance after your visit.
